Let's talk about the interpretation of the result: In the end, Lin Ying said that she would disappear in a month, so the tragic ending was already destined, but the author stopped abruptly before the tragedy and stopped at the climax before the tragedy. At this time, Lin Ying and Mu Mu had expressed their feelings for each other and had moved to a new home. The author focused this article on the beauty of this moment. Continuing to push down, it is not difficult to know that Lin Ying disappeared, but Li Xingmu still survived in the world, which was hinted in the previous article. Fei Wei had suicidal tendencies, and he once said that "Lin Ying" saved him, indicating that this "Lin Ying" was Fei Wei after he committed suicide. "Lin Ying" rescued Fei Wei who was about to commit suicide and started a relationship with him. However, a month later, "Lin Ying" disappeared, and then the story of Lin Ying and Li Xingmu began. At the beginning, Lin Ying woke up from the hospital, and just as "Lin Ying" disappeared, Fei Wei sent her to the hospital. Tragedy was doomed from the beginning. Lin Ying is like the one-month-long repository for the soul of a person who committed suicide. Come and save yourself who didn't commit suicide, and make your original self live a better life. Fei Wei, the rich second generation who married Sa Sa, committed suicide for unknown reasons. The dead Fei Wei's soul rested on Lin Ying's body for a month. Then he rescued Fei Wei and became boyfriend and girlfriend, and even left a selfie of him smoking and wearing men's clothing. Later, "Fei Wei who became Lin Ying" was told by Lin Ying's original owner that his soul would dissipate in one month and that this body would be given to the next person. "Fei Wei" chose short-term pain rather than long-term pain to break up with Fei Wei. Then the body was given to Li Chunmu, who committed suicide, and many lovely photos were left on that phone. A month passed quickly. This body is still there, but "Fei Wei" and "Li Chunmu" are no longer there. Who will forget him or her, and who will remember her?
